Top 100 Most Viewed Titan Quest Videos by Switch Tech
Video Title | Views | Category | Game | |
---|---|---|---|---|
1. | Titan Quest | FPS Check • Nintendo Switch Gameplay | 1,725 | Titan Quest |
Video Title | Views | Category | Game | |
---|---|---|---|---|
1. | Titan Quest | FPS Check • Nintendo Switch Gameplay | 1,725 | Titan Quest |